Producer, Design Human Factors Team

Cupertino, California, United States

The Apple Design group is seeking a Producer to support the Human Factors research team.

Description

The Design Human Factors Producer will be focused on highly complex projects that require an additional level of oversight and direction. This is a fast-paced, collaborative position in which you will need to understand how and who to work with to orchestrate a research program plan, and successfully manage execution of that plan. This individual will collaborate with a variety of teams and individuals both within and outside the Design team. In this role, you will coordinate week-to-week activities to meet team objectives including :

  • Manage research project tracker to clarify resourcing, timelines, and priorities
  • Help Human Factors team members overcome project roadblocks
  • Coordinate weekly meetings and agendas with primary research and project teams
  • Coordinate with Design and Engineering producers on project roadmaps
  • Identify and develop key partners in cross-functional teams
  • Track schedule and delivery of prototypes for research studies
  • Partner closely with Human Factors researchers and collaborators to be aligned on above activities

Pay & Benefits

At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$172,100 and $305,600,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location.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ple's disc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ple's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You'll also receive benefits including :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ses including tuition. Additionally, this role might be eligible for discretionary bonuses or commission payments as well as relocation.
